Hearing the Voice 2. (360G-Wellcome-108720_Z_15_Z)
Hearing the Voice 2 builds on the achievements of Hearing the Voice 1 (2012-2015) by extending our interdisciplinary inquiry into voice-hearing (or auditory hallucinations) into seven new domains. In Voices and the Senses, we investigate the relation between the sensorially varied experience of voice-hearing and both normal and atypical ways of perceiving the world. Voices and Memory integrates medical humanities and cognitive neuroscientific approaches to understanding how voice-hearing is rooted in personal experience. Voices and Creativity explores the role of heard voices in creativity across media and genres. Voices, Language and Communication builds on our approach to understanding voices as communicative acts from social agents. Understanding why some voices cause suffering is our focus in Voices, Emotions and Distress. Voices Across the Life-Course centres on three multidisciplinary longitudinal studies exploring how voice-hearing is shaped by personal, social and cultural acts of meaning-making which change over time. In Voices Beyond the Self, we consider how voices act as social and and political forces across cultures and historical periods. The project will continue our methodological investigation into processes of interdisciplinarity, develop a major new online resource for voice-hearers andclinicians, and pursue an innovative programme of arts-led public engagement.
